Yoo!
Im using Ableton Live, and thought of buying a controller so that im able to arrange my tracks live and then go back and fix the eventual mistakes etc.
I want to be able to trigger ableton clips while controlling parameters and faders so i got full control over my track.
I've heard about the Akai APC 20/40? Anyone using any of these?
Also i've heard of the M-Audio UC33 Evolution, and the Novation Launchpad?
What do you guys think is suitable for my needs?
Thanks a lot mates!

APC 40 all the way. It is made specifically for Ableton, hence the name Ableton Performance Controller. Also works straight out of the box so you won't even have to midi map all the knobs and faders to the parameters. Super fun to play around with too.
